Book excerpt: Excerpt from Sketches and Studies in South Africa Some whose judgment I value are of opinion that the following "Sketches and Studies" may be of general interest. If so, it will be chiefly because the views and opinions expressed in them have been formed, not by reading books - although I have read everything on the subject which has come in my way for many years - but because I have had opportunities of conversing freely with men who know, on all sides of the questions involved. South Africa is, for many reasons, one of the most interesting parts of the Empire; and it has before it - one cannot doubt - a great future. It affords examples of some of our gravest mistakes and gives us, therefore, lessons for the time to come. It is encouraging, as being the theatre of some of the most energetic efforts of Engishmen. I am unable to recount any striking or sensational journeys in waggous, or any hair-breadth escapes in pursuit of 'big game"; but to many it may be interesting to realise what rapid strides civilisation has made in a land scarcely known until recent years, and what a wealth of interest and beauty belongs to a region still - as a part of the Empire - young. Book excerpt: Excerpt from A Trip to South Africa IN the following pages Mr. Salter-whiter has described his recent visit to the Cape in a manner that cannot but be of value. Starting from his own home he describes each incident of the journey, and points out the evils to be avoided and the advantages to be secured. He sees clearly the dangers of the coast land at the Cape and the remarkable virtue of the Karoo district. He shews the value of sunshine, dry air, and elevation in securing arrest, even in cases of advanced disease, and in Chapter XV., on Health, ' he sketches out a route likely to be of essential service to many. The course pursued must vary in different cases, but the advantages of beginning with Wynberg, then going to Ceres, Matjesfontein, and Bloemfontein are clearly exhibited.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Annals of the South African Museum, 1964-1967, Vol. 48 This paper represents the second part of a systematic account of the hydroids of the south and west coasts of South Africa. The first part, dealing with the Plumulariidae, appeared in these Annals, vol. 46, 1962. The scope of the work and the source of the material were detailed in the introduction to Part I, and need not be repeated here. As before the details of the collecting stations are given in the station list which follows, and only the catalogue numbers are quoted in the systematic account. Occasional records which do not come from the south or west coast, but which have been mentioned for some special reason, have been put between brackets.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The graphic novel is the most exciting literary format to emerge in the past thirty years. Among its more inspired uses has been the superlative adaptation of literary classics. Unlike the comic book abridgments aimed at young readers of an earlier era, today's graphic novel adaptations are created for an adult audience, and capture the subtleties of sophisticated written works. This first ever collection of essays focusing on graphic novel adaptations of various literary classics demonstrates how graphic narrative offers new ways of understanding the classics, including the works of Homer, Poe, Flaubert, Conrad and Kafka, among many others.
